						<section><p>In any proceeding in a district <span class="dictionary">court</span> or <span class="dictionary">circuit</span> <span class="dictionary">court</span> where a juvenile is alleged to have committed a <span class="dictionary">delinquent act</span>, the Commonwealth shall be permitted to introduce <span class="dictionary">evidence</span> establishing the age of the juvenile at any time prior to adjudication of the case.</p></section></text><history>1994, c. 913; 1996, cc. 755, 914.</history><metadata></metadata></law>
